Eclectic Singer-Songwriter first album...music influenced by rock, reggae, folk, and R&B styles
Bio / Background
This is the debut album of Brett Shurman, a psychiatrist by day and closet singer-songwriter by night. This album is a the culmination of a three year collaboration between Brett and Rob Mullins, a well established L.A. Jazz artist and composer. Rob helped Brett develop and achieve his holy grail- -to create an album of songs worthy of being heard. Various musicians and recording professionals from the Rob Mullins band contributed to the excellent musicianship and production on this album. Brett and Rob hope that the music and lyrics from this album will inspire a sense of interest and wonder as it did for them during its creation.
Brett has heard many interesting interpretations of the meaning of this album. He feels in retrospect that each song in the album reflects the barriers to self-perception. What else would you expect from a musical shrink? Feel free to review the album and leave your own interpretation.
